Six-year-old Imogen Cantong, a member of “It’s Showtime’s” resident “batang cute-po” kiddie panel, highlights the unique joys of Filipino childhood in her debut single “Da Da Da.”

The upbeat track was inspired by the melody Imogen used to sing when she was only two years old.

Her parents Rey Cantong and Kaye Cantong of Six Part Invention composed and produced the song which looks back on the fun memories of a happy childhood.

“Yung Da Da Da po for me ay para sa mga babies na hindi pa nakakapagsalita. I composed it for them po. Ang meaning po ay parang nagyayaya [na makisaya sa awitin],” said Imogen.

Aside from being a resident panel member for “It’s Showtime’s” “Isip Bata” segment and being one of the featured singers in Jamie Rivera’s “3-in-1” song, she is also a performer who has passion for singing and dancing.

Due to her parents’ musical career, she took interest in singing and dancing at a young age.

She enjoys performing at school programs that help her hone her confidence as well.

“When I was two years old po lagi ako nagwa-watch ng music videos then lagi ko po sila ginagaya.

Also nakikita ko po parents ko na nagpe-perform kaya nagustuhan ko na rin po mag-perform,” Imogen shared.

Now, she bravely takes a step forward toward her dream as she releases her first single as a recording artist.

She looks up to various local and international artists such as Regine Velasquez-Alcasid, Sarah Geronimo, Blackpink, Ariana Grande, and her parents’ band Six Part Invention.
